It may not be immediately clear how these companies are connected to one another. In this investigation, we will provide an ...
PLC ("TC BioPharm" or the "Company") (NASDAQ: TCBP), a clinical-stage biotechnology company developing platform allogeneic gamma-delta T cell therapies for cancer and other indications, today 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results